A Theology of Christian Counseling

di Jay E. Adams

A Theology of Christian Counseling connects biblical doctrine with practical living. Salvation, that central concern of Protestant theology, is often too narrowly defined. It is thought of as "being saved from the consequences of sin." But God is doing much more. He is making something new out of the old sinful nature. He is, in Christ, making new creatures."No counseling system that is based on some other foundation can begin to offer what Christian counseling offers. . . . No matter what the problem is, no matter how greatly sin has abounded, the Christian counselor's stance is struck by the far-more-abounding nature of the grace of Jesus Christ in redemption. What a difference this makes in counseling!"In this book the reader will gain an insight into the rich theological framework that supports and directs a biblical approach to counseling. And the connection between solid theology and practical application will become compelling. This book is one-of-a-kind.… (altro)

A very practical look at how good theology can provide a strong underpinning to the process of helping others with their problems. In the process, as with all these books, I found much practical help for me and my problems. Not difficult to read at all. ( )

Many good forms of practical advice. The author strongly objects to modern psychiatric concepts and finds all material necessary for counseling in God's Word. While I have general agreement in most forms of the practical work, I take strong objection to the Calvinism of the author. All my objections stem from this theological viewpoint and its constant intrusion in the work, portrayed as Gospel truth. ( )

Adams careful instruction thoroughly connects the counseling situation to the truths that are to be believed and yielded to. Adams is a master teacher, so his writing is filled with secondary sidebars, that prove quite fruitful as he lectures his way through the book. Transactional forgiveness became key for me in my own understanding of sin and repentance. Adams was helpful and trustworthy as a theologian and counselor providing useful examples of change and repentance.
